Pep Guardiola lauds Jack Grealish after dedicating goal to late brother

Manchester City head coach Pep Guardiola hailed his team’s midfielder Jack Grealish after he dedicated his goal against Leicester City at the Etihad Stadium on Wednesday night. Grealish scored early in the second minute of the game and dedicated the goal to his late brother Keelan.

Wednesday marked the 25th anniversary of his passing and Grealish posted on social media: “With me always, especially this day. That was for you, Keelan.”

Keelan was just nine months old when he died in April 2000, when Jack was just four.

“Jack is an incredible human being,” said Guardiola.

“I didn’t know [about the anniversary]. I can’t imagine how tough it can be for mum and dad, his sister and all the family.

“It’s good that this day he remembers him. I’m pretty sure they remember every single day. He scored a goal and made a good game.”

This was the English footballer’s first league goal of the season after a frustrating season with injuries and poor form. Guardiola gave an opportunity to Grealish in the middle and he was able to grab it with both hands.

“He likes to play in the middle,” added Guardiola.

“He’s a guy who used to play free. He’s comfortable playing on the side. Always between the lines he has ability. I’m happy for him. I know it’s not easy when you don’t play regularly. Last game in the FA Cup he played really good.”

This loss leaves Leicester City in the 19th place in the Premier League standings and they are on the verge of relegation with only eight games remaining.

“For me, the most important thing is I stay at it and evaluate the games and be the best manager I can be in this situation,” said manager Ruud van Nistelrroy. “That is my job, in an extremely difficult moment. I expect myself to be the first one to react in a good way.”

Manchester City will next take on derby rivals Manchester United at Old Trafford on Sunday.
